First, let’s talk about capacity, measured in milliamp-hours (mAh). This is basically the fuel tank for your vest. A higher mAh rating means a longer run time. For a full day of moderate heat, I look for a battery in the 10,000 to 20,000 mAh range. If I’m just going for a short walk, a smaller, lighter 5,000 mAh pack might be perfect. Next is voltage. You must match this to your vest’s requirements. Most vests run on 7.4V, but some use 5V or 12V. Using the wrong voltage can damage your vest or the battery, so double-check your manual.
Portability is another huge factor for me. A massive battery might last for ages, but if it’s too heavy or bulky to comfortably wear on the vest’s pocket or your belt, what’s the point? I look for a slim, lightweight design that doesn’t feel like I’m carrying a brick. The type of ports matters, too. A battery with a USB-C port is great for modern, fast charging, while USB-A ports are compatible with older cables. Some power banks even have a DC output, which is often the most efficient way to connect to your vest.
Finally, I always check for built-in safety features. A good battery for a heated vest should have protection against overcharging, short-circuiting, and overheating. FAQ
How long does a battery typically last on a single charge?
This is the most common question I get, and the answer is, “it depends.” It varies massively based on the battery’s capacity (mAh), your vest’s power settings, and the outside temperature. On a low heat setting with a 10,000 mAh battery, you might get 5 to 7 hours. Crank it up to the highest setting, and that same battery could be done in under 2 hours. A larger 20,000 mAh battery can often last a full workday on a medium setting.
Can I use any power bank with my heated vest?
Not exactly. You can’t just grab any phone power bank and expect it to work. The two critical things to check are voltage and connector type. Your vest is designed for a specific voltage (like 7.4V). Using a standard 5V phone bank might not provide enough power, or it might not work at all. You also need the right cable to connect it, which is often a DC barrel plug, not a USB cable. Always check your vest’s manual for its power requirements.
Are there batteries designed specifically for heated clothing?
Yes, and they are often your best bet. Companies like Ororo, Venustas, and Dewalt make batteries specifically for their heated apparel. These are great because they are guaranteed to be compatible with the correct voltage and often come with the right connector. However, many universal power banks with the correct output specs also work perfectly and can be a more affordable or higher-capacity alternative.
How should I store my battery when not in use?
I always make sure to store my batteries properly to make them last longer. I keep them in a cool, dry place, away from direct sunlight. It’s best not to store them completely fully charged or completely empty for long periods. A charge level between 40% and 60% is ideal for storage. Also, never leave a battery connected to the charger indefinitely after it’s full.
What does the mAh rating on a battery mean?
mAh stands for milliamp-hour, and it’s a unit that measures the battery’s capacity. Think of it like the size of a gas tank. A 5,000 mAh battery holds less “power” than a 20,000 mAh battery. A higher mAh rating generally means the battery will power your heated vest for a longer time before it needs to be recharged.
